Eleanor Croucher [Tarrant] (1824-1869)


Dates

Birth: 1824 Portsea,Hampshire, UK
Father: John Croucher 1787-1873
Mother: Rachel Taylor b1799-1842

Christening: 19 September 1824 St Mary's, Portsea, Hampshire, UK

Marriage: April-June 1846 Alverstoke, Hampshire, UK
Husband: William Tarrant c1780-1855

Death: July-September 1869 Portsea, Hampshire, UK

Children

Fanny Louisa Tarrant [Goddard] 1848-a1901
William John Tarrant 1851-a1901

Notes

Christening of Eleanor Croucher in the IGI on 19 September 1824 in St Mary's, Portsea, Hampshire, parents John Croucher and Rachel.

In the 1841 census as Elenor Croacher (sic - in the index, Croucher on the original) aged 16, born in Hampshire, and living with John and Rachel Croacha (parents?), Charles, Frederick, James and William (brothers?), Sarah (sister?) and Thomas Taylor (aged 28, born in Hampshire and a tailor) in Upper Arundell Street, Landport and Southern , Portsea, Hampshire.

Her mother died in April-June 1842 in Portsea, and her father married Ann Moore in 1844.

Marriage of Eleanor Croucher and William Tarrant in FreeBMD in April-June 1846 in Alverstoke (7 38).

In the 1851 census as Eleanor Tarrant aged 28, born in Portsea, Hampshire and living with her husband (William), son (William John), daughter (Fanny) and widowed sister-in-law (Frances Day aged 63, born in Brading, and a proprietor of houses) at 4 Princes Street, Kingston, Portsea, Hampshire.

Her husband died in January-March 1855 in Portsea.

In the 1861 census as Eleonor (sic) Tarrant aged 37, born in Portsea, Hampshire, widowed, employment illegible and living with her son (William) and daughter (Fanny) at 13 Buckingham Street, Portsea, Hampshire.

Death of Eleanor Tarrant in FreeBMD in July-September 1869 aged 46 in Portsea (2b 275).

Her husbands date of birth is based on the almost illegible 1851 census entry - 11 in the index, but I believe 71 on the original which ties in with the age of his sister Frances.
